BACKGROUND

 

General Information: The Multifamily Housing Revenue Bonds will be issued in accordance with Tex. Gov’t Code §2306.353 et seq., which authorizes the Department to issue bonds for its public purposes, as defined therein. Tex. Gov’t Code §2306.472 provides that the Department’s multifamily housing bonds are solely obligations of the Department, and do not create an obligation, debt or liability of the State of Texas or a pledge or loan of faith, credit or taxing power of the State of Texas.

 

Development Information: The development proposes the Adaptive Reuse of a historic building that will provide 48 units of Supportive Housing for vulnerable populations.  The existing structure, located at 2801 Wycliff Avenue in Dallas, Dallas County, was built in 1967 and served as a dormitory and flight attendant training center for Braniff airlines.  The building is currently unoccupied.  A 2024 Traditional Carryforward designation was received from the Bond Review Board which does not have a restriction regarding the Area Median Family Income (AMFI) households to be served.  The application reflects that all of the units will be rent and income-restricted at 60% of AMFI. 

 

Organizational Structure and Previous Participation: The Borrower is Braniff Lofts, LP, and includes the entities and principals as illustrated in Exhibit A.  The applicant’s portfolio is considered a Category 2 and was deemed acceptable.

 

Tax Equity and Fiscal Responsibility Act (TEFRA) Public Hearing/Public Comment: On March 18, 2022, the IRS released Revenue Procedure 2022-20, which permanently allows TEFRA hearings for qualified activity bonds to be held telephonically.  Staff conducted a telephonic hearing for the proposed development on July 30, 2025.  Representatives from the Department and the Developer were present, and no public comment was made.  A copy of the transcript is included herein.  The Department has not received any letters of support or opposition for the development.

 

Summary of Financial Structure

 

Under the proposed structure, the Department will issue unrated, variable rate tax-exempt bonds in the aggregate principal amount of $20,000,000, to be purchased by Bank OZK.  The bonds are intended to be construction financing only, with a maturity date that is 36-months, inclusive of one six-month extension, from the date of closing (or approximately September 2029).  The construction period interest rate will be based upon the SOFR Term Rate, as published by the Chicago Mercantile Exchange (CME), plus 230 basis points, estimated at the time of underwriting to be 5.95%.  Hunt Capital Partners LLC will provide a construction loan in the amount of $5,300,000. Upon conversion, the permanent loan is anticipated to be in the amount of $6,000,000 with a 15-year term and 6.00% interest rate. The principal will be paid from residual cash flow.   The City of Dallas approved a loan in the amount of $7,000,000, with a 20-year term to be paid with surplus cash flow at an interest rate of 1.00%.
